#f1234d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f1234d is composed of 94.5% red, 13.7%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.5% magenta, 68%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 347.8 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 54.1%. #f1234d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ff469a with #e30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

Shades and Tints of #f1234d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#feeef1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f1234d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8688 is the less saturated color, while #fa1a48 is the most saturated one.
